PLUG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2017 in Review

111 of the 4,034 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Plug Power (PLUG) for Q1 2017, worth a combined $53.2M — down 8.5% from $58.2M a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 18 funds closed out of PLUG and 13 opened new positions — a net loss of 5 holders — while 25 trimmed existing stakes and 34 added.

The largest buyer was BlackRock, adding an estimated $14M. The largest seller was Hudson Bay Capital Management, cutting an estimated $11.6M.
